Engine Specs Cadillac ATS-V vs BMW M3

Both the ATS-V and BMW M3 come with standard rear-wheel drive and a six-cylinder engine. The Cadillac’s engine, however, offers more horsepower and more torque for a lower starting MSRP. More torque and horsepower means a more responsive and exciting driving experience.
